D

😄 Sidd international is an excellent company. The ...

😄 Sidd international is an excellent company. The products are of the highest quality and the customer service is outstanding. I had a great experience shopping on their website, and the entire process was hassle-free. I would highly recommend Sidd international to anyone.

Comments:

No comments